Suffering from persistent knee pain can significantly impact your daily life, here limiting mobility and overall well-being. Conventional treatments like medication and physical therapy may provide temporary relief, but they often fail to address the underlying cause of the pain. Stem cell therapy has emerged as a revolutionary treatment option for knee pain by harnessing the body's natural healing capabilities.

These therapy involves injecting concentrated stem cells into the affected area of the knee joint, where they can attach with damaged tissues and stimulate tissue regeneration. Stem cells have the unique ability to differentiate into various cell types, including cartilage, bone, and ligaments, offering them a versatile tool for repairing knee injuries.

  • Various types of stem cells can be used in knee pain treatment, each with its own advantages.
  • Autologous stem cells are typically extracted from the patient's own body or a suitable donor.
  • Scientific studies have shown that stem cell therapy can alleviate knee pain and improve joint function in patients with osteoarthritis, ligament tears, and other knee injuries.

While ongoing a developing field, stem cell therapy holds immense potential for transforming the treatment of knee pain.

Stem Cell Therapy for Knees: Weighing the Pros and Cons

Stem cell therapy is emerging as a innovative treatment option for individuals with knee injuries or degenerative conditions. This advanced approach harnesses the body's own cells to heal damaged cartilage and minimize pain. While stem cell therapy offers several anticipated benefits, it's crucial to completely consider both the pros and cons before undergoing this procedure.

  • On the favorable side, stem cell therapy has the ability to promote natural healing processes, leading to enhanced joint function and mobility. Many patients report a significant decrease in pain and stiffness after treatment.
  • However, it's important to note that stem cell therapy is still a relatively recent field with ongoing research. The long-term outcomes of this therapy are not yet fully understood, and there can be possible risks associated with the procedure.

Some patients may experience transient side effects such as swelling at the injection site. In rare cases, more severe complications can arise. It's essential to discuss a qualified medical professional to determine if stem cell therapy is an appropriate option for your individual condition and to understand the potential benefits and risks involved.

Stem Cell Therapy for Knees: A Look at Success Rates

For individuals grappling with knee pain and debilitating osteoarthritis, stem cell therapy presents a glimmer of hope. This innovative treatment harnesses the remarkable regenerative potential of stem cells to repair damaged cartilage and alleviate symptoms. While success rates vary depending on factors such as the severity of damage and individual adaptability, clinical studies have shown promising findings.

Stem cell therapy for knee repair typically involves injecting a concentrated dose of stem cells into the affected joint. These cells, capable of transforming into various types of tissue, have the potential to stimulate bone regeneration and reduce inflammation.

  • Numerous studies suggest that stem cell therapy can effectively decrease pain, improve functionality, and enhance overall level of life for patients with osteoarthritis.
  • Nonetheless, it's crucial to understand that stem cell therapy is not a guaranteed solution. Individual responses can vary widely, and further research is needed to fully understand the long-term impacts of this treatment.

Speaking with a qualified orthopedic surgeon specializing in stem cell therapy is essential for determining if this treatment is appropriate for your individual needs and expectations. They can provide personalized advice based on your medical history, condition, and comprehensive health status.
